The City of Texas City's Economic Development Corporation (EDC) Board of Directors held a meeting on July 29, 2026, primarily focused on reviewing and approving the fiscal year 2027 budget. The budget presentation detailed a proposed reduction in spending to approximately $4.3 million, including allocations for new positions, promotions, and a sales tax rebate line. Key procurement-related discussions included contracts with professional organizations for engineering and geotechnical services related to major infrastructure projects such as road construction and Shaw Point development. The board also reviewed grant programs supporting local business improvements and chamber membership reimbursements, with specific budget amounts allocated for these initiatives. Additionally, the board approved a final payment resolution to the Edifice Group for weather-related damage under a chapter 380 sales tax reimbursement agreement. Other procurement topics included maintenance contracts for community facilities, advertising and marketing expenditures aligned with strategic plans, and software subscriptions critical for economic development operations. The meeting concluded with updates on significant industrial projects and workforce development initiatives. The fiscal year 2027 budget was unanimously approved by the board.
